Streamline Recruitment have partnered with a fantastic client to support their recruitment drives and are now looking to appoint a Transport & Contracts Logistics Planner (Night Shift) to join their operations team. This position plays a key role in coordinating transport across a mix of commercial and utility-based work, ensuring service delivery is maintained to a high standard, particularly within time-sensitive and reactive environments.
Working within a fast-paced operation, you will be responsible for planning vehicle and driver activity, managing real-time changes, and liaising with both internal teams and external providers to keep services running efficiently.
The role will involve:
- Coordinating daily transport plans across multiple contracts
- Allocating drivers and vehicles in line with availability and driver hours regulations
- Managing live changes to schedules, particularly during incidents or disruptions
- Working with third-party logistics providers and monitoring service delivery
- Maintaining clear communication with drivers, clients and internal teams
- Supporting out-of-hours and emergency response activity when required
- Ensuring all activity is compliant with transport and health & safety regulations
This role would suit someone who is organised, confident making decisions under pressure, and comfortable working in a reactive environment. Previous experience within transport planning or logistics is important, along with strong communication and IT skills.
